What should a leader do to enhance team communication?

Implementing regular check-ins and creating an open atmosphere for discussion is essential for enhancing team communication. This approach fosters a culture of transparency and encourages team members to share their thoughts, concerns, and ideas freely. Regular check-ins provide structured opportunities for team members to communicate, share updates, and address any challenges they may be facing.

An open atmosphere promotes collaboration and makes individuals feel comfortable participating in conversations. This dynamic encourages innovation, strengthens relationships within the team, and helps to build trust. When team members feel heard and valued, their engagement increases, leading to improved teamwork and productivity.

In contrast, limiting discussions to formal meetings restricts opportunities for casual and spontaneous communication, which can hinder collaboration. Relying solely on written communication can lead to misunderstandings and a lack of personal connection among team members. Focusing strictly on sharing information without encouraging dialogue misses the opportunity to build relationships and engage in meaningful conversations that can drive team success.
